The design of light source is crucial for the availability of palmprint, hand shape and high quality image of Handmetric identification. After the small (small lighting area, Gao Liangdu) LED light source is added at the front end of an appropriate optical component, it may assist to redistribute the LED flux in receiving specific distant source within a specific range. It may also favor in reducing the volume of light source. Such can be done during the improvement of the uniformity of illumination. The light’s utilization of surface is also objective. This paper analyses in detail of the track’s changes before and after the light through optical components by comparing the use of flux distribution and optical component. The results show that the uniformity is improved after luminous flux component’s distribution.
